BSU Hosts Seminar on Cyber Hygiene and Online Protection
A scientific seminar on cybersecurity, jointly organized by Baku State University (BSU) and Codelandia LLC, was held in honor of March 27 – Science Day.
The seminar featured presentations by Shahin Soltanov, Azerbaijan's special representative at Checkpoint Cybersecurity, and Togrul Khalilov, a cybersecurity specialist at Codelandia LLC, on the topic “Cyber Immunity: Cyber Hygiene and Protection Against Online Dangers.”
BSU Vice-Rector Huseyn Mammadov highlighted that such events provide students with valuable opportunities to enhance their knowledge and skills in information technology, aligning their expertise with labor market demands.
During their presentations, Shahin Soltanov and Togrul Khalilov discussed various approaches to strengthening cybersecurity, enhancing system and user resilience against cyber threats, ensuring information security, protecting personal and corporate data, and preventing cyberattacks.
The speakers also shared insights on strengthening security systems, the importance of regular updates, the use of artificial intelligence, network security, and the critical role of the human factor in cybersecurity. Additionally, they addressed strategies for protecting companies and individuals from cyber threats, the future of cyber immunity, and the implementation of innovative solutions against emerging cyber risks.
The discussion also touched on the role of artificial intelligence and machine learning in cybersecurity, as well as the development of national cybersecurity strategies.
The seminar concluded with an engaging discussion, allowing participants to exchange ideas and gain deeper insights into the evolving landscape of cybersecurity.
